The Importance of Mental Stimulation for Dogs

Understanding the needs of our canine companions includes acknowledging the significance of mental stimulation alongside physical exercise. While it is widely recognized that regular walks and playtime are vital to a dog’s physical health, the mental component of their well-being is often overlooked. Insufficient mental challenges can lead to a myriad of issues, including boredom and behavioral problems, which can manifest in forms such as excessive barking, chewing, or other anxiety-related behaviors. Thus, engaging your dog’s mind through various stimulating activities and toys is a key aspect of their overall health regimen.

The Role of Interactive Puzzle Toys

Interactive puzzle toys are designed specifically to engage a dog’s problem-solving skills. These toys often feature compartments or mechanisms that encourage dogs to manipulate parts in order to release treats or engage with the toy in new ways. For instance, some puzzles may require a dog to nudge a series of levers or lifts to gain a tasty reward hidden within. This type of mental exercise is not only rewarding for dogs but also beneficial in keeping their cognitive abilities sharp.

The market offers a wide range of these products, from snuffle mats, which simulate a foraging experience, to treat-dispensing toys that release goodies when rolled or shaken in a specific manner. These toys are both enjoyable and challenging, making them a perfect tool for mental stimulation. The Benefits of Chew Toys

Chewing is a natural behavior for dogs, serving not only as a method to relieve stress and anxiety but also as a form of mental engagement. Chew toys crafted with this in mind are designed to be durable and complex, often featuring embedded treats or unusual shapes that require effort to manipulate. This encourages dogs to engage mentally, as they puzzle out how to best access their reward. Products like rubber chew toys and firm nylon bones are popular options. These toys are not just about chewing; they keep a dog’s mind active and provide hours of distraction and amusement.

The Allure of Plush Toys with Hidden Compartments

Plush toys with hidden compartments add another layer of intrigue to playtime. These toys are typically designed with pockets, flaps, or hidden sections where treats can be stashed. This setup compels dogs to utilize their sense of smell and innate curiosity to discover and retrieve the hidden treats. This sort of play not only challenges their intelligence but also mimics natural hunting behaviors, providing mental reinforcement.

The Introduction of Electronic Toys

Advancements in technology have led to the creation of electronic toys that introduce a new realm of interaction for canines. These modern toys offer multiple features such as sound, movement, and app-compatibility, allowing owners to control the toys from a distance, even remotely. Some electronic toys can be programmed to dispense treats at intervals, or even engage in interactive games that respond to a dog’s actions. Such toys are particularly beneficial for dogs that spend time alone, as they offer a dynamic form of mental stimulation that keeps them engaged and less prone to boredom.
